Nacogdoches, Texas (United States of America) - "Outlast Nacogdoches". Outlast is a 6 hour and 12 hour trail endurance challenge where runners complete a 5K every hour, on the hour. Each lap must be finished within the hour to stay in the event. If you finish early, you rest until the next round. Miss a lap, and you’re out. Complete all six or twelve rounds, and you outlast. The 1st Place 6 Hour Male and Female champions from each city will earn a spot in the Outlast Championship, where they’ll compete against the best of the best at the end of the tour. 4 laps = Bronze “Grit Earned” leather patch, 5 laps = Silver “Survivor” leather patch, 6 laps = Premium “Outlast” 6 Hour wooden medal, 12 laps = Premium “Outlast” 12 Hour wooden medal. Jacksboro, Texas (United States of America) - "North Texas Ultra". The North Texas Ultra is a 5K, 10K, 25K, 50K, 52 Miler, 100K run & 25K RUCK held on Fort Richardson State Park's Trailway in the foothills of North Texas. Featuring an open, scenic, historical, and paved with soft fine gravel. The race follows a 15.5-mile out & back course beginning and ending at the North Park Unit. Cat Springs, Texas (United States of America) - "Jackalope Jam". The Jackalope Jam is a 6-hour, 12-hour, 24-hour, 48-hour, 72-hour, and 100-hour timed event where you record the greatest distance possible during your chosen duration while running, walking, hiking, or competing in our separate ruck divisions. New in 2025, you can also compete as a 2–6 person team in the 24-Hour Relay. Every participant receives a medal, and solo competitors completing 100 kilometers or more earn a buckle. The event is held at 7IL Ranch, which offers open access all week, course-side camping, great facilities, and beautiful landscape. The out-and-back course is exactly 2 miles (one mile out, one mile back) on a short-grass/gravel farm road, with one main aid station at the start/finish fully stocked with a Texas-sized ultra buffet, including real food for overnighters. Runners are encouraged to set up their own tent and support area along the course. It is common for runners to take long rest breaks, sleep, or even leave and return later to complete more miles. Only fully completed laps count toward distance, with medals awarded for sub-100k distances and bonus patches for ruck participants. Relay pricing and format allow each additional team member to trigger a $10 refund for previous members. All members pay the same amount, with larger teams reducing the per-person fee. The relay is open format with no designated order or number of laps per member; exchanges can only occur at the start/finish after completed laps. Team changes must be finalized by the captain before registration closes. Teams can compete in all-male, all-female, or coed divisions (minimum 2 female).
